1) Nsd when terminated will usually also create and NSD file in the IBM Technical support directory. if it is incomplete it will usually be small in size a typical nsd will be around 10MB in size or even higher. Look for the Generated Messages at the bottom of the nsd for any messages. if you don't see the Generated messages secition it likely terminated withot completeing
2) for debugging a crash semdebug.txt is usually not needed. if a memory dump is created it is possibly due to a memory overwrite and the corefile would likely be very useful with crash analysis. and as always nsd is very valuable
